Adult basic life support.

SAFE approach: Shout for help, Approach with care, Free from danger and Evaluate.

check responsiveness (shake)

responsive: check his condition, get help if needed and reassure him regularly.

unresponsive: shout for help

open airway: head tilt, chin lift. (avoid head tilt if trauma to the neck is suspected).

Check breathing: look listen and feel up to 10 seconds.

breathing present : recovery position.

no breathing: call 999 and give 2 effective breaths, check airway and ensure head tilt and chin lift.

Assess circulation, movement/pulse up to 10 sec. (carotids)

circulation present: breath for one minute and reassess

no circulation: give chest compression's: 100 per minute (position yourself vertically above the victim's chest and, with your arms straight press down on the sternum to depress it between 4-5 cm.). Single rescuer:- 2:15, two rescuers:- 1:5.

Continue resuscitation until:- (i) qualified help arrives, (ii) the victim shows signs of life, (iii) you become exhausted.
